Primary School Netters Key: Tauvia

There is a need to develop netball in primary schools if the sport is to grow, says Isikeli Tauvia.
The Western Lewasewa Netball Primary Schools tournament coordinator made the comment after the two-day event ended at Lawaqa Park on Wednesday with Lautoka dominating by winning four of the six titles.
“The competition has improved compared to the last two years. It has lifted to another level and a positive development for the sport going forward,” Tauvia said.
“This kind of competition is very important for our young girls especially if we want to produce good future netball players, teach them the skills from an early age.
“We need to set a pathway for them to become good netball players and future Fijian Pearls.
“There is so much talent out there, all we need is to find them and develop them early.”
A total of 68 teams from seven districts in the western division took part.

RESULTS
Semifinals
U9: Ra 5 – 3 Ba, Lautoka 3-1 Nadroga;
U10: Lautoka One 7 – 6 Lautoka Two, , Nadroga 7 -5 Navosa.
U11: Lautoka 8 -2 Nadi, Lautoka Two 6 – 5 Nadroga;
U12: Lautoka One 12 – 5 Navosa Two, Nadi One 12 – 4 Nadi Two;
U13: Lautoka One 13 – 2 Navosa, Ra 9 – 6 Nadroga;
U14: Lautoka One 14 -3 Lautoka Two,
Finals
U9: Ra 6 -1 Lautoka; U10: Lautoka 7 -5 Nadroga; U11: Lautoka One 8-3 Lautoka Two; U12 Lautoka 13 – 12 Nadi; U13: Lautoka 12 -10 Ra; U14: Lautoka 8 – Nadi 9.
